原文:node-rsa 非对称加密和解密

使用公钥和私钥的加密和解密: 非对称加密的关键在于 有公钥 私钥用法:a.生成一对公钥私钥b.公钥加密 gt 对应私钥解密c.私钥加密 gt 对应公钥解密 非对称加密的常见应用方式a.公钥加密,发给私钥拥有者,私钥解密获得明文。其它人用公钥解不开b.私钥加密 签名 公钥的传输 混合加密 a.使用对称加密算法发布公钥b.使用对称加密算法解密公钥,再使用公钥加密明文,发给私钥拥有者 注:不能 公钥加密 ...

2018-09-26 16:33 0 1350 推荐指数:

查看详情

node-rsa非对称加密

写在最前:此文的目的是介绍编码,减少刚接触时的弯路,所以内容且不做详细累述 一.使用 node-rsa 进行非对称解密 因为 比特币 中使用的非对称加密,所以在npm中对比找到一个比较方便也直观的库:node-rsa非对称加密的关键在于 有 公钥 / 私钥 用法: a. ...

Thu Jun 28 23:39:00 CST 2018 4 1534
JAVA的非对称加密算法RSA——加密和解密

第一部分:RSA算法原理与加密解密 一、RSA加密过程简述 A和B进行加密通信时,B首先要生成一对密钥。一个是公钥,给A,B自己持有私钥。A使用B的公钥加密加密发送的内容,然后B在通过自己的私钥解密内容。 二、RSA加密算法基础 整个RSA加密算法的安全性基于大数不能分解质因数 ...

Mon Mar 20 19:04:00 CST 2017 0 1562
NodeJS使用 node-rsa 加密解密

const NodeRSA = require('node-rsa'); const fs = require('fs'); // 公钥加密 function encrypt(data) { const publicKey = fs.readFileSync('./files ...

Sun Jun 30 20:58:00 CST 2019 0 1610
Java对称非对称加密解密,AES与RSA

加密技术可以分为对称非对称两种. 对称加密,解密,即加密解密用的是同一把秘钥,常用的对称加密技术有DES,AES等 而非对称技术,加密解密用的是不同的秘钥,常用的非对称加密技术有RSA等 为什么要有非对称加密,解密技术呢 假设这样一种场景A要发送一段消息给B,但是又不想以明文 ...

Fri Mar 10 19:37:00 CST 2017 0 2378
非对称加密-RSA

非对称加密-RSA 1.1任务描述   任务描述某人相对少量需要传输的数据进行较高水平的加密,并不在意速度的快慢,他该怎么做? 1.2课程目标 了解非对称加密的概念和优缺点。 了解RSA的概念。 了解RSA算法。 学会使用RSA工具加解密。 1.3什么是非对称加密 ...

Sun Oct 11 01:29:00 CST 2020 0 1752
(转)C#实现RSA非对称加密解密

转自:http://blog.csdn.net/u010678947/article/details/48652875 一、RSA简介 RSA公钥加密算法是1977年由Ron Rivest、Adi Shamirh和LenAdleman在(美国麻省理工学院)开发的。RSA取名来自开发他们三者 ...

Sat Dec 17 05:08:00 CST 2016 0 4246
Python使用rsa模块实现非对称加密解密

Python使用rsa模块实现非对称加密解密 1、简单介绍: RSA加密算法是一种非对称加密算法 是由已知加密密钥推导出解密密钥在计算上是不可行的”密码体制。加密密钥(即公开密钥)PK是公开信息,而解密密钥(即秘密密钥)SK是需要保密的。 RSA密钥至少为500位长,一般推荐使用1024位 ...

Fri Jan 03 03:44:00 CST 2020 0 947
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M